Handover note — Crumbwheel order cutoffs.

Welcome aboard. The bakery cutoff rule in Crumbwheel closes same-day orders at 14:00 local to each storefront, not UTC — this has bitten us twice. Holiday overrides live in the calendar service and take precedence silently, so always check there first when a cutoff looks wrong. To unlock the calendar service's admin console after a restart, enter the recovery passphrase below.

vault phrase of bagap-bahaf = silion-pelox-sorox-casdor-quenwyn-fraax-eliox-praael-kelion-quenvan-kasox-rusael-norius-belvan

Handover: calendar sync conflict in Plannerly

To the reviewer: the double-booking bug comes from our Quillsync worker applying remote deletions before local edits land, so the conflict resolver sees a phantom event and re-creates it. My fix serializes per-calendar mutations through a single queue and adds a tombstone TTL so deletions survive a retry window. Watch the ordering logic in the merge step carefully. The worker was tested against the staging broker with these settings.

config for tawif-bagef:
[sorwyn]
team = sorys
access_code = ac_9ba40c
host = sorwyn.ordingrid.local
port = 5000
owner = aldok.quenion
peer = belath.paliqcloud.local

# Quick context for eng sync: the Pixelforge thumbnail queue was backing up
# every Monday morning when the weekend upload batch landed. Turns out our
# worker pool was sized for average load, not the spike, and retries were
# piling on top. We've split the queue into a fast lane for small images and
# a slow lane for the giant RAW files, each with its own concurrency cap.
# Please don't "temporarily" bump these during an incident without telling
# the sync channel. The current knobs are defined right here.

tuning table, fawip-fahag:
WEIGHTS = {
    "novwyn": 452,
    "casdor": 675,
}

Step 6 — TilePull Prefetcher Deploy (Norvane Maps)

Stop the prefetcher daemon. Pull the new image, tag it `stable`. Confirm cache quota is set per region config. Restart with warm-start flag so the Ardenport tiles aren't refetched. Do not skip the signature verification step; the daemon refuses unsigned bundles. Verify the bundle with the deploy key that follows:

rollout seal: bky4_x7Gc